The `Tangle` source would create a point field generically named `nodevar`. This name was not indicitive of the data or its source. Thus, the output point field has been renamed `tangle`. The `Tangle` source was also creating a cell field (named `cellvar`). This field was really just a mirror of the cell indices (counting from 0 on up). This field has been removed from the input. If you want such a field, you can now use the `GenerateIds` filter to add it to any data set.
